前端开发中如何解析json数据(二)
来源:互联网 发布:对淘宝客服的理解 编辑:程序博客网 时间:2024/06/05 21:13
数据二、
{
"china":{
"hangzhou":{"item":"1"},
"shanghai":{"item":"2"},
"chengdu":{"item":"3"}
},
"America":{
"aa":{"item":"1"},
"bb":{"item":"2"}
},
"Spain":{
"dd":{"item":"1"},
"ee":{"item":"2"},
"ff":{"item":"3"}
}
};
像这样的json数据,对象里面嵌套对象。Json数据的值是对象,该对象的值也是一个对象。
下面我们就来一下如何解析该json数据。
首先通过for-in循环遍历json数据value,其中countryObj 为value对象的一个属性名,value[countryObj] 为value对象的属性值, 在这里也是一个json对象如:
"china":{
"hangzhou":{"item":"1"},
"shanghai":{"item":"2"},
"chengdu":{"item":"3"}
},
它也是一个json对象,于是 value[countryObj][cityObj]["item"]便可以取到json对象中item的值,或者value[countryObj][cityObj].item。
总之分清是json还是array这是很关键的。但是如果我们用for(var cityObj in value.countryObj)遍历json数据的时候是没有用的,这一点要知道的。最终将json数据中的值显示在页面上。
- 前端开发中如何解析json数据(二)
- 前端开发中如何解析json数据(一)
- 前端开发中如何解析json数据(三)
- Android开发之解析JSon数据(二)
- “快速递”开发历程(二)Volley解析json数据
- 解析JSON数据(二)
- Json数据解析(二)
- Android中如何解析JSON数据
- Android中如何解析JSON数据
- Qt中如何解析Json数据
- json数据解析二
- 前端开发如何模拟后端返回json数据
- json(2)---前端如何处理json数据
- Json数据如何解析?
- Json数据如何解析?
- 多叉树结构:JSON数据解析(二)
- android json数据解析(二)
- Gson解析Json数据(二)
- 离线配置gradle时,打开Android Studio会报错 “Error:Gradle distribution 'https://services.gradle.org/distribution
- ES6 函数扩展
- 蓝牙核心技术与应用学习笔记
- 维基百科搬运 树 (数据结构)
- Thread子类中,不能使用Spring注解,变量为null
- 前端开发中如何解析json数据(二)
- iOS 自定制弹框
- 服务器延迟原因汇总
- @SerializedName注解
- cannot resolve symbol DefaultHttpClient等之类的提示
- c#中全局变量与局部变量的设置
- 欢迎使用CSDN-markdown编辑器
- Leetcode 8. String to Integer (atoi)
- 服务器延迟原因汇总